The Palms Golf Club in Mesquite is a William Hull-designed championship course that strikes the perfect balance of traditional and desert golf. The front nine on the par-71 course boasts an old-fashioned, all-grass layout with generous, forgiving fairways that reward long drives. The high desert landscaping is broken up by 28 acres of water in play on all but one of the holes. But the real test of skill comes with the mountainous back nine, a roller-coaster ride through and around rolling canyons with dramatic elevation drops from tee to green. On this side, shot placement is key. The 15th hole in particular is truly stunning, featuring a spectacular view and vertical drop of more than 100 feet from the tee to the fairway. The course at Palms Golf Club measures more than 6,800 yards, accented by serene lakes, sand traps and more than 200 gently swaying palm trees.
The Palms Golf Club may be the oldest 18-hole course in Mesquite, but time has only improved it. The course is impeccably maintained and boasts an almost tropical feel, thanks to the beautifully established palms.
